What is biomagnification which lesson?

Some persistent chemicals such as DDT and PCB bioaccumulate in the organism and become concentrated at levels which are much higher in living cells than in water. Bioaccumulate is repeated at each step of the food chain. The process of increasing concentrated through the food chain is called biomagnification.

What is bioaccumulation and biomagnification for kids?

Bioaccumulation takes place in a single organism over the span of its life, resulting in a higher concentration in older individuals. Biomagnification takes place as chemicals transfer from lower trophic levels to higher trophic levels within a food web, resulting in a higher concentration in apex predators.

What are 2 situations in which biomagnification can happen?

Biomagnification can occur in both terrestrial and aquatic environments, but it is generally used in relation to aquatic situations. Most often, biomagnification occurs in the higher trophic levels of the food chain/web , where exposure to chemicals takes place mostly through food consumption rather than water uptake.

What chemicals can Biomagnify?

Biomagnification and food-web accumulation Some of the biomagnified chemicals are elements such as selenium, mercury, nickel, or organic derivatives such as methylmercury. Others are in the class of chemicals known as chlorinated hydrocarbons (or organo-chlorines).

What are the steps of biomagnification?

Process of Biomagnification

  • Toxic chemicals and pollutants get mixed up in the environment.
  • Chemicals and pollutants are consumed by the small plants called Phytoplankton.
  • These small plants are consumed by small marine animals called Zooplankton.
  • Zooplankton are then consumed by small fish.
  • Bigger fish consume smaller fish.

How does the biomagnification work?

Biomagnification occurs when the concentration of a pollutant increases from one link in the food chain to another (i.e. polluted fish will contaminate the next consumer and continues up a tropic food web as each level consumes another) and will result in the top predator containing the highest concentration levels.

How can biomagnification affect humans?

Humans who are affected by biomagnification tend to have a higher risk of developing certain cancers, liver failure, birth defects, brain damage, and heart disease. The toxins responsible for these health problems include: mercury, lead, chromium, cobalt, and cadmium.
